Desiccants are another category of chemical therapies that operate in a different way from insecticides.
Chemical insecticides can pose wellness threats if consumed or inhaled. For that reason, it is advised to take necessary safety measures throughout the therapy process. This may include ensuring that animals and youngsters are maintained out of treated locations for certain durations, usually described in the producer's directions. After therapies, comprehensive cleansing and ventilation of the space can assist alleviate any remaining chemical residues, making it safer for re-entry by animals and youngsters.
When handling a bed bug invasion, it's vital to recognize not only the effectiveness of the chemical treatments utilized yet additionally the safety of various other residents in the home, specifically pets. Using chemicals can posture dangers, and as a result, applying stringent security standards is essential. Before beginning any type of chemical therapy, it's advisable to eliminate petssuch as cats and dogsfrom the facilities.

Lots of chemical tags have details directions pertaining to the secure re-entry times for animals and humans, which need to always be complied with. During therapy, family pets must be transferred to a safe environment far from the chemicals, ideally a close friend or member of the family's home. In situations where that isn't possible, a closed area far from the therapy site weblink with enough air flow and no exposure to the chemicals should be developed.
Moms and dads and caregivers need to take positive procedures to secure children from exposure to insecticides and other chemicals used in parasite control (bed bug services). To make sure safety, it is a good idea to remove children from the treated area throughout and after the application of chemical treatments. Typically, professionals advise vacating the home for a minimum of 2-4 hours, and in many cases, it may be essential to keep like this away for a full day, relying on the specific substances made use of
